Claim this charityAbout Anton Proksch-Fonds
The Anton-Proksch-Institut foundation in Vienna researches and treats all forms of addiction, originally established in 1956 as the Stiftung Genesungsheim Kalksburg under the patronage of social affairs minister Anton Proksch. It supports the Anton-Proksch-Institut, one of Europe's largest addiction clinics, which treats substance dependencies such as alcohol, medication and drugs as well as behavioural addictions like gambling and gaming. The foundation funds research and awards a research promotion prize in the field of addiction medicine.
Mission
To support research and comprehensive treatment of addictive disorders through the Anton-Proksch-Institut in Vienna.

Anton Proksch-Fonds is in Austria, a TGE (Transnational Giving Europe) member country. Dutch donors can route gifts via Stichting Transnational Giving Europe to receive Dutch ANBI-equivalent deductibility, subject to TGE's 5% pass-through fee.
Anton Proksch-Fonds is registered in Austria. US donors generally cannot deduct gifts to non-US charities directly. To claim a deduction, route the gift through a US 'Friends of' fiscal sponsor or a donor-advised fund that performs equivalency determination (IRS Rev. Proc. 92-94).
